Remarque : Le code a réussi le test dans le projet réel. J'ai omis certaines parties sans importance. Vous pouvez vous concentrer sur la partie codée par couleur des préliminaires : Question : Pourquoi faites-vous cela ? ? Réponse : Il existe une fonc
Symptômes du problème Aujourd'hui, lorsque je développais une page mobile H5, j'ai rencontré le problème que l'interface ne pouvait pas revenir à sa position d'origine lorsque le clavier était rétracté sur IOS. Les problèmes et symptômes s
Pour supprimer une valeur dans le tableau et renvoyer un nouveau tableau, vous devez parcourir l'ancien tableau pour trouver l'élément à supprimer. Copiez le code comme suit : /* * Supprimez la valeur spécifiée dans le tableau*/ Array.prototype. s
J'ai lu beaucoup de questions sur la redistribution récemment, mais je n'avais pas remarqué ce phénomène auparavant. Récemment, j'ai commencé à l'étudier lentement. Après tout, je n'ai pas prêté attention à de nombreux détails de perfo
Dans le chapitre précédent, j'ai présenté qu'un module d'édition de zone partielle pouvait être ajouté à la page masquée. Dans ce chapitre, je présenterai la page parent pour afficher le calque de masque et faire apparaître une boîte de dialog
Lors de la création de pages Web, il est très courant d'utiliser des balises pour l'affichage classifié. Les balises aux coins arrondis présentent les avantages d'un beau style et d'une expression vive. Généralement, nous transformerons l&
En téléchargeant des images de tailles appropriées, les utilisateurs peuvent prévisualiser l'effet similaire à un diaporama en sélectionnant l'effet et la musique de l'animation de rendu, et enfin cliquer pour confirmer pour générer une vidéo,
Qu’est-ce que requestAnimationFrame ? Dans les programmes d'animation par navigateur, nous utilisons généralement une minuterie pour faire défiler l'objet cible toutes les quelques millisecondes afin de le faire bouger. Maintenant, il y a une bonn
1. JavaScript est sensible à la casse ; 2. Si vous déclarez une variable sans écrire var, vous avez déclaré une variable globale ; toute fonction qui n'est pas une méthode est une variable globale, et celle-ci pointe vers la fenêtre ; opérateur, trouv
M. Exemple de saut de page à l'intérieur d'une boîte #box { page-break-inside: void; } Description Cet attribut définit si la pagination se produit dans un élément spécifié.
Il n'y a pas de meilleur, seulement du meilleur. Comme le titre l'indique, cet article souhaite uniquement partager un effet de mouvement de particules obtenu à l'aide de Canvas. Cela ressemble un peu à un titre, mais d'un autre point de v
Il existe un projet dans lequel la zone de saisie surveille la saisie en temps réel et déclenche la demande. La première idée est d'utiliser la méthode onchange() sur l'entrée. Je l'ai essayée, mais cela ne fonctionne pas. Elle ne sera déclenc
jQuery 2.0 supprime le jugement du numéro de version du navigateur (il recommande la détection des fonctionnalités). Voici une méthode de jugement native écrite par un étranger. Ce code est vraiment astucieux ! À la fois bref et rétrocompatible ! L'ap
L'une des principales caractéristiques de l'outil CSS est qu'il est conçu pour fournir une prise en charge parfaite des navigateurs de classe A. La prise en charge des navigateurs de notation est purement une notation Yahoo!, et vous pouvez vo